Your last measurement should be just about the same as
the 1st two measurements. On a good armature all
three measurements should be the same.
Here is a measurement form a bad armature. The 1st
two contacts will almost be 10 ohms over the original
readings of 18 ohms.

Here is the 3rd and final reading of the bad armature,
notice the extreamly high reading here. Carefull inspection
of the underside of the armature on the contact with the
highest reading will usually yeild a broken wire. In
some cases you will be able to unwind it once and
re-solder it with no noticable impact in the
preformence of that armature. The resistence may
be just ever so slightly off.
Here is a picture of a Bad Armature. Notice
the disconnected wires hanging out to the right.

Here is a reference picture of an AF/X armature.
Notice the 2 Red laminations.
This armature measures about 14 ohms on each connection.
Here is a reference picture of a Tuff Ones armature.
This armature measures about 8 ohms on each connection.
mgarm quadarm
Here is a reference picture of a Mean Green armature.
Notice the copper colored windings and the 2 green laminations.
This armature measures about 6 ohms on each connection.
Here is a reference picture of a Quadralam armature.
Notice the copper colored windings and the 4 black laminations.
This armature measures about 4 ohms on each connection.
